Regarding steroid
Hi, Me and my family recently diagnosed with covid 19 and we all are recovered but my concern is about my husband because his chest ct scan showing some infection so doctor prescribed hi. To take predemt 8mg for 5 days (2 times in a day) and then she prescribed symbicort turbuhaler 160/ 4.5 for 2 puff in two times in a day for one month My concern is that steorid can create eyes problem like glaucoma or cataract. Is it okay to continue the steorid inhaler or he should stop. And due to covid situation hè cannot visit for eye check up.

Hi ..you must take medication as prescribed by the doctor . He must be having some patch in the lungs for which all this is prescribed and necessary.  It is ok to take under doctors supervision.Generally short term steroid will not give rise to any problems , but if you feel concerned,  you can do an eye check after 2 weeks.

Yes.Thats true.Steroid can cause cataract and glaucoma but if it is taken for a long period of time.
Next Steps
He should do as adviced by the physician and can visit the ophthalmologist once his general condition settles.
